Transaction 3e2895065a1bc79c87d2301657f866bde4eab4fb9c3c87908bf56b7df2326441

2 Input
2 Outputs
  • 3e2895065a1bc79c87d2301657f866bde4eab4fb9c3c87908bf56b7df2326441:0
  • value  528045
    address  33WhHDaRGbPPjYYBuyCuEfRy9LaibBoZSk
  • 3e2895065a1bc79c87d2301657f866bde4eab4fb9c3c87908bf56b7df2326441:1
  • value  5423
    address  bc1q0frts53jswdygkqjhe6mparkwlcd4qltmmnvg4